MCC NEET PG 2025 counselling round 3 choice filling to end soon

New Delhi: The Medical Counselling Committee (MCC) is soon going to end the NEET PG Round 3 Counselling registration, payment and choice filling/locking process for the academic year 2025-26 admissions.
According to the revised schedule released by the Medical Counselling Committee (MCC) on January 15, the registration, payment, and choice filling/locking process for NEET PG Round 3 counselling 2025 will conclude on January 26, 2026. Following this, the seat allotment process will begin on January 27, 2026. The seat allotment results will then be declared on January 29, 2026.
Thereafter, candidates can start the reporting and joining process from 30th January 2026. After his, the verification of the joined candidates' data by the institutes sarong of data of MCC will be done on 7th February 2026. Below is the detailed NEET PG Round 3 counselling 2025 schedule-
REVISED SCHEDULE
ROUND III | |||||||
SL. NO. | VERIFICATION OF TENTATIVE SEAT MATRIX BY THE PARTICIPATING INSTITUTES AND NMC | REGISTRATION/PAYMENT | CHOICE FILLING/LOCKING | PROCESSING OF SEAT ALLOTMENT | RESULT | REPORTING/JOINING | VERIFICATION OF JOINED CANDIDATES' DATA BY INSTITUTES SHARING OF DATA TO MCC |
1 | 15th January 2026 | 15th to 26th January 2026 Upto 12:00 Noon as per Server Time * Payment facility will be available up to 03:00 PM of 26th January 2026 as per Server Time | 16th to 26th January 2026 (Choice Filling will be available upto 11:55 P.M of 26th January 2026) as per Server Time Choice Locking will start from 04:00 P.M of 26th January 2026 upto 11:55 P.M of 26th January 2026 as per Server Time | 27th to 28th January 2026 | 29th January 2026 | 30th January 2026 to 6th Feb., 2026 | 7th February 2026 |
DAYS | (1-Day) | (12-Days) | (11-Days) | (2-Days) | (1-Day) | (8-Days) | (1-Day) |
Meanwhile, the NEET PG Round 3 counselling 2025 for the All India Quota (AIQ) quota, Deemed and Central Quota will end on 14th February 2026. On which, the last date of joining and sharing of the joined candidates' data by MCC will start from 6th February 2026. Below is the detailed schedule-
REVISED SCHEDULE FOR ALL-INDIA QUOTA/DEEMED/CENTRAL STATE QUOTA
S.NO. | SCHEDULE FOR ADMISSION | ALL INDIA QUOTA/DEEMED/CENTRAL UNIVERSITIES | SHARING OF JOINED CANDIDATES' DATA BY MCC | STATE COUNSELLING | SHARING OF JOINED CANDIDATES' DATA BY STATE DMEs’ STATE COUNSELLING AUTHORITIES |
1 | Round 3 | 15th to 29th January 2026 | 6th and 7th February 2026 | 27th January 2026 to 7th February 2026 | 14th February 2026 |
2 | Last date of joining | 6th February 2026 | _ | 13th February 2026 | _ |
